Minute 1 - 1 rep each exercise. Minute 2 - 2 reps each exercise. Minute 3 - 3 reps each exercise. And so on until the 20th minute - 20 reps each exercise.
Of course Dave had other plans for me in terms of scaling it up. Instead of normal burpees, I had the choice of muscle ups, handstand push ups or the hand stand burpee. I chose the handstand burpee because I had never done it before and it sounded the most interesting.
A handstand burpee is where you initiate a burpee as usual: squat down, jump your feet back, do a push up and jump feet back up to your hands. But instead of jumping in the air, you keep your hands planted on the ground and kick your legs up in to a handstand position (against a wall).
